Product Milestones & Phases

Phase 1: OSS Core & CLI (Active Release)

Establishing the local-first execution runtime.

  • WebGPU Accelerated Runtime: Zero-dependency fast local inference running directly in browser sandbox memory.
  • Quantized GGUF inference: Direct support for custom model weights via system command runtimes.
  • OpenAI-Compatible server daemon (privane serve): Full SSE completions streams support.
  • Local Sandboxed Execution: Safe filesystem folders and SQLite query keywords filtering.

Phase 2: Privane Cloud & Managed Infrastructure (In Progress)

Scaling execution capabilities for enterprise agent workloads.

  • Hosted Virtual Browser Nodes: Cloud browser session virtualization integrated directly with Browserbase & PinchTab.
  • Transient OAuth Gateway: Safe, stateless connection hub managing SaaS authentication storage, refresh sessions, and permission scopes for Slack, GitHub, Gmail, and Notion.
  • Real-time DOM Pruner: Extraction engine that prunes raw layout HTML into structured accessibility schemas cloud-side, cutting token transmission costs by over 95%.
  • Metering & Operational Tracing: Tracing pipeline, usage analytics, billing triggers, and rate-limiting enforcement.
